In classical conditioning, CS stands for Conditioned Stimulus, which is a previously neutral stimulus that, after becoming associated with the unconditioned stimulus (US), eventually comes to trigger a conditioned response.

Conditioned Stimulus

In classical conditioning, a previously neutral stimulus that, after becoming associated with the unconditioned stimulus, eventually comes to trigger a conditioned response.

Conditioned Response

A learned response to a previously neutral stimulus that has become associated with an unconditioned stimulus through conditioning.
